Mistplay is the #1 loyalty app for mobile gamers. Our community of millions of engaged mobile gamers come to Mistplay to discover new games to play and earn rewards. Gamers are rewarded for their time and money spent within the games and can redeem those rewards for gift cards. As a Principal Backend Engineer I at Mistplay, you will play a critical role in defining the technical architecture to be able to support the continued growth of the business. You will be working with a diverse and talented team of software engineers, product managers and designers to understand and implement product and engineering driven initiatives.

What you’ll do at Misplay
• Act as the technical subject matter expert to ensure technical capabilities align with our Product team to ensure technical initiatives are well align with our Product roadmap;
• Determining and developing pragmatic and achievable refactoring initiatives. Ensure that our BE engineering members are on the same way;
• Developing and designing highly scalable features and systems.
• Identifying possible risks and dependencies in our projects and mitigating them;
• Breaking down complex technical epics into executable engineering tasks;
• Working with our DevOps team to create an efficient CI/CD pipeline to ensure we can push code to production reliably, confidently; 
• Leading code reviews, ensuring that we are growing our codebase in a performant, scalable, maintainable way;
• Run frequent knowledge transfer, lunch & learn sessions with our engineering members to set best practices, and foster a healthy engineering culture. 

What you’ll bring to Mistplay
•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Software Engineering or equivalent
• 10+ years experience working in an engineering driven product organization, at least 2 of which leading complex technical initiatives 
• Strong knowledge running production grade APIs in a cloud native environment (AWS); 
• Strong knowledge in DynamoDB or similar no-sql database; 
• Great verbal and written communication skills;
• Ability to lead technical discussions, and keep them on track/point; 
• Experience and knowledge at the framework level: ExpressJs, NestJS (an asset);
• Experience with Python (an asset)
• Experience with Docker, Kubernetes and related container technologies (an asset);
• Specifically knowledge of running APIs on ECR/EKS (an asset); 
• iOS, Android or Progressive WebApp experience (an asset).

What you need to know about the Toronto Tech Scene

Although home to some of the biggest names in tech, including Google, Microsoft and Amazon, Toronto has established itself as one of the largest startup ecosystems in the world. And with over 2,000 startups — more than 30 percent of the country's total startups — Toronto continues to attract new businesses. Be it helping entrepreneurs manage their finances, simplifying business operations by automating payroll or assisting pharmaceutical companies in launching new drugs, the city's tech scene is just getting started.
